NEWPORT BEACH, Calif.—Over 60 people from a cross-section of the optical industry, including lens, frame, and equipment companies and optical labs, attended The Vision Council's second Town Hall Meeting to hear information on technical standards, government regulations, industry statistics and a special presentation by guest speaker, Dean Browell, PhD, of Feedback, a company that specializes in social media strategy.   Dave Plogmann, director of industry relations for Think About Your Eyes, presented information about the rollout of the national Think About Your Eyes consumer awareness campaign. A segment called The Vision Council 101 included information on tapping into the value of membership in The Vision Council, including sales and marketing tips and technical information on standards. Time was devoted to those laws affecting businesses in California such as Prop 65, which requires a "duty to warn" label on products when certain chemicals are used in the creation of products, such as lenses or frames.   See more
